data_agumentation.py
时间: 2023-08-09 11:01:38 浏览: 73
data_augmentation.py是一个用于数据增强的Python脚本。数据增强是指通过对原始数据进行一系列变换和扩充,生成更多样化和丰富的训练样本。
该脚本主要包含了几个常用和常见的数据增强方法,统一集成在一个脚本中,方便使用和调用。
在data_augmentation.py中,一些常见的数据增强方法包括:
1. 镜像翻转:对图像进行水平或垂直翻转,产生镜像对称的新图像。
2. 旋转变换:对图像进行旋转操作,通过指定旋转角度和插值方式,在保持内容不变的情况下改变图像的角度。
3. 尺度变换:根据指定的比例因子,缩放图像的尺寸,可以放大或缩小图像。
4. 平移变换:通过指定平移的距离,将图像在水平和垂直方向上进行平移操作。
5. 亮度调整:通过调整图像像素的亮度,使图像变亮或变暗。
6. 噪声添加:向图像中添加一些随机噪声,可以是高斯噪声、椒盐噪声等。
7. 裁剪操作:根据指定的区域,对图像进行裁剪,得到感兴趣的区域。
这些数据增强方法可以用于图像分类、目标检测、语义分割等任务中,可以有效增加训练数据的多样性,提升模型的泛化能力和性能。
总之,data_augmentation.py提供了一些常见的数据增强方法,通过对原始数据进行变换和扩充,生成更多样化和丰富的训练样本,有助于提升机器学习模型的性能和鲁棒性。
相关问题
data_sampler.py作用
data_sampler.py 的作用是从给定的数据集中随机采样一部分数据。它的主要目的是在大规模数据集中提供一个有效的方法来获取一个较小的子集,以便进行模型训练、评估或测试。数据采样可以帮助缩小数据集的规模,减少计算资源的需求,并且可以用于构建更快速、更高效的模型。在 data_sampler.py 中,可以通过设置采样的数量或采样的比例来控制所需的数据量。
input_data.py文件下载tensorflow
要在Python中下载TensorFlow,可以使用以下步骤在input_data.py文件中进行下载:
首先,打开你的Python开发环境,比如PyCharm或者Jupyter Notebook。
然后,创建一个新的Python文件,命名为input_data.py。
接下来,在文件中输入以下代码:
```python
import tensorflow as tf
import os
# 设置下载路径
data_dir = "./data/"
if not os.path.exists(data_dir):
os.makedirs(data_dir)
# 下载MNIST数据集
from tensorflow.examples.tutorials.mnist import input_data
mnist = input_data.read_data_sets(data_dir, one_hot=True)
```
保存文件并运行,TensorFlow将会被下载到你的项目文件夹中。在这个例子中,我们使用了MNIST手写数字数据集作为示例。你可以根据你的需求替换其他数据集的名称来下载不同的数据集。
下载完成后,你就可以在Python环境中使用TensorFlow进行机器学习和深度学习的任务了。希望这些步骤能够帮助你成功地下载TensorFlow到你的项目中。
相关推荐
![py](https://img-home.csdnimg.cn/images/20210720083646.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)